CSW960CP Power supply input 1x 230Vac/2x 400-500Vac / output 24Vdc 40A
Single phase and two-phase input 185…480 Vac
Short circuit, overload, input and output overvoltage protections
Over temperature protection
Suitable for applications that require high reliability and performance
Smart alarm contact, signals when output voltage drops more than 10%
High overload capability to ensure the protections selectivity and start-up of heavy loads

UNIVERSAL POWER

Universal input DIN rail switching power supplies (185…550 Vac) Single / Two-Phase / Three-Phase for industrial automation and process control applications. The input circuit technology makes them immune to overvoltages caused by faults in three-phase networks with a neutral, increasing application reliability. Compared to single-phase power supplies, this series offers greater reliability in industrial environments. The input stage uses components with a 900 V working voltage, which are more resistant to the voltage spikes found in industrial networks than the components used in single-phase units. The ability to operate from 185 to 550 Vac allows these power supplies to be used in both 230 V single-phase and 400 V three-phase networks.

Main Features

  • Extended Input Range (185…550 Vac): Can be powered by 230…240 Vac single-phase, 208 Vac two-phase, or 400…500 Vac two-phase and three-phase for maximum adaptability to AC networks, eliminating the need for an isolation transformer.

  • Two-Phase Input: Reduces overall dimensions, wiring, installation costs, and cabinet space.

  • Elimination of Transformers: Removes the need for a matching transformer for mains voltage.

  • DC OK Alarm Contact: Versions available with an alarm contact.

  • High Efficiency: Reduces energy consumption and component operating temperatures, allowing for use in small enclosures and severe environmental conditions.

  • Large Power Reserve: Capable of delivering at least +50% of the nominal current for 5 seconds, ensuring safety and reliability.

  • Adjustable Output: Protected against incoming overvoltages from the DC line and equipped with electronic protection that shuts down the output in case of an internal fault.

  • Short-Circuit and Overload Protection: Dimensioned to provide inrush currents exceeding 150% of the nominal value (required by heavy loads), while thermal protection prevents failures during prolonged overloads in high ambient temperatures.

  • Robust Construction: Ensures excellent ventilation of internal components, very compact dimensions, and IP20 protection against accidental contact according to IEC529.

  • Compact Design: Thanks to high efficiency and good ventilation, these are among the smallest on the market.

Greater Reliability
Compared to single-phase power supplies, this series offers higher reliability in industrial environments.

The input stage uses components rated for 900 V operating voltage, which are more resistant to voltage spikes typically present in industrial networks than the components used in single-phase units. The ability to operate from 185 to 550 Vac makes these power supplies immune to common grid faults:

When the input is supplied at 230 Vac (L1-N), in the event of a short circuit in another device connected to L2-N, the neutral potential rises to approximately 400 Vac and the input becomes supplied phase-to-phase until the protection device trips, which, in the best-case scenario, occurs within 300 ms. This is one of the most frequent causes of failure in 230 Vac single-phase power supplies operating in industrial environments (Figures 1 and 2).

Another failure case for 230 Vac single-phase devices supplied between phase and neutral is caused by the accidental disconnection or interruption of the panel neutral from the plant neutral. Without the return path to the star point, the neutral rises to phase voltage and applies approximately 400 Vac to the single-phase loads, making failure unavoidable.

Typical Application with Three-Phase Network and Neutral
In this configuration, the neutral is used to derive a 230 Vac supply to power loads (in the example, a simple light bulb) and power supplies.

A simple short circuit on the load causes the neutral potential to rise; all equipment connected to it will then be supplied between two phases, that is, at approximately 340–400 Vac instead of 230 Vac.
